Algebra I<br> Evaluate each function. h ( n ) = 2 n − 5 ; Find h ( 2 )
slavikrds [6]

Answer:

h ( 2 ) = - 1

Step-by-step explanation:

<u>Two-Variable Functions</u>

A function expresses the relation between two variables in such a way that for each input for the independent variable n, there one and only one value for the function h(n). If it's explicitly given as an equation, then we can use values for n as we wish, and compute the different values of h(n).

The question provides the following function

h ( n ) = 2 n - 5

We are required to find h(2), which can be computed by replacing n by the value of 2

h ( 2 ) = 2 (2) - 5

h ( 2 ) = 4 - 5

h ( 2 ) = - 1

Find the 10th term <br><br> 3,15,75,375
vova2212 [387]

Answer:

5859375

Step-by-step explanation:

These are the terms of a geometric sequence with n th term

a_{n} = a_{1} r^{n-1}

where r is the common ratio and a_{1} the first term

here r = \frac{375}{75} = \frac{75}{15} = \frac{15}{3} = 5 and a_{1} = 3, hence

a_{10} = 3 × (5)^{9} = 5859375
